titleOfInvention | Fibrous nano-carbon |
abstract | The present invention relates to a conductive and thermally conductive polymer composite material, a fuel cell catalyst carrier, a unit carrier catalyst such as organic chemistry, a gas storage material of methane butane and hydrogen, an electrode material and a conductive material of a lithium secondary battery, and a high capacity electric Graphite formed of a stack of carbon hexagonal planes formed of sp 2 hybridization bonds of carbon atoms, which may be used as an electrode material of a double layer capacitor, and is composed of 95% or more carbon atoms. It has a similar structure and has a distance of 0.3360 nanometers or 0.3800 nanometers between carbon hexagonal meshes measured by X-ray diffraction method, and has a stack size of at least 4 layers and has an aspect ratio. : An island having a fibrous shape having a fiber length / fiber diameter) of 20 or more, and having an average cross-sectional width of the fibrous carbon of 2.0 to less than 800 nanometers (nm).
